there is a patch available for this that needs to be applied to irssi for focal from GitHub issue: "A change in GLib 2.63 broke some assumptions in Irssi that the null- byte NUL / U+0000 is a valid Unicode character. This would occur when the user types Ctrl+Space. As a result, the input loop never manages to process the NUL-byte (and any other user input that follows, ever).
